Tapeswaram

Tapeswaram is a village located in Mandapeta mandal of East Godavari district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Mandapeta (tehsildar office) and 49km away from district headquarter Kakinada. As per 2009 stats, Tapeswaram village is also a gram panchayat.

About Tapeswaram

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tapeswaram is 587580. The village spans a total geographical area of 636 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 533340. Mandapeta is nearest town to Tapeswaram village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 4km away.

Population of Tapeswaram

Below is a concise population overview of Tapeswaram as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 7,411 3,661 3,750
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 706 350 356
Scheduled Castes (SC) 1,077 526 551
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 88 44 44
Literate Population 5,007 2,602 2,405
Illiterate Population 2,404 1,059 1,345

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Tapeswaram village:

  • The total population of Tapeswaram village is around 7,411, including approximately 3,661 males and 3,750 females, with a sex ratio of 1024 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 706 children aged 0–6 years in Tapeswaram village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Tapeswaram village has 1,077 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 88 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Tapeswaram village is about 67.56%, with male literacy at 71.07% and female literacy at 64.13%.
  • There are around 2,187 households in Tapeswaram village.

Connectivity of Tapeswaram

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tapeswaram. As per the 2011 stats, Tapeswaram had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
